Knowing When to Strike
Every single aggressive action you take in the arena should be dictated primarily by the opponent's current bank of elixir.
This situation—having significantly more energy than the opponent—is known as an 'Elixir Advantage', and creating it is the primary goal of the game.
- Counting elixir tells you if they can afford their heavy spell.
- If they are at zero, they cannot immediately punish your 6-elixir Elixir Collector investment.
- It prevents 'over-defending'.
Mental Arithmetic Under Pressure
Tracking a constantly shifting number in your head while managing complex micro-interactions on the screen is incredibly difficult for beginners.
Eventually, this process will become completely automatic; you will instinctively 'feel' their elixir bar without having to consciously calculate the numbers.
| Resource Level | Your Required Action |
|---|---|
| You have a massive Elixir Advantage (+4) | Immediate, overwhelming aggression; punish their lack of resources before they can regenerate |
| You have a massive Elixir Deficit (-4) | Immediate, flawless defense; sacrifice tower health if necessary to regain economic parity; do NOT attack |
